How did they change the length ?? by redoing the Molding of the handle ??

When Prince's OEM manufactures the racquet they cut to the appropriate length when it comes out if the mold. When racquets come out if the mold they are longer than 27 inches.

I didn't strung it, just touched it. And the mold was surely not any Aerogel racket. To me it looked like one of the older Revelation Tour rackets from the 90es.
And regarding the length: It's just a matter where you cut the rackets when they come out of the mold. If Tommy says he wants 69,8 cm he gets it. If he wants 70,3 cm he will get it as well (if the mold is long enough). You don't need any **** for this.

How does any pro use something so light? I don't even see any lead on it, you would have to add about an oz of lead just to make it decent
1. You can hide the lead under the bumper.
2. The pro rackets are usually produced seperately. So you can adjust the weight at the production. (Not precisely on one or two gramms but you can make a racket which has 300 gr. in the retail version with 320 oder 330. That's no problem.)
3. You don't have to use lead tape. I tuned my rackets with silicon and you donÄt see nothing. Even my Prestiges have 20 gr. added in the head.
